    SUMMARY

    The Patient Coordinator greets and assists visitors and customers in a friendly, attentive, and helpful manner. A PC is an outstanding customer service professional and The Source+ of education to assist customers with our products. Checking customers into the dispensary and collecting all necessary information for State compliance to properly allow them to purchase products. Also, responsible for completing multiple transaction types, which include in-store, curbside, and home deliveries, while ensuring that the best experience possible is delivered to build positive customer relationships.

    WORK AUTHORIZATION/SECURITY CLEARANCE

    • There is no visa or H1-B sponsorship. Candidates must successfully complete a criminal record screening or FBI Fingerprints requirements.
    • Successful completion of a thorough personal reference check and background check from the Nevada Division of Public and Behavioral Health. Note that any applicant with a violent felony or drug-related offense (Conclusion of sentence, probation, and/or incarceration within the past 10 years) is not eligible to become a dispensary agent.
